Output 3dd06cbf207889641cf320a3369f1580cdc28a2319b305f70ac0958e0d4b2876:5

value
1048576
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aafd415db87598ee887339e8f82e5a997baaf37330f5295698e6d0949971d5e0
address
bc1p4t75zhdcwkvwazrn8850stj6n9a64umnxr6jj45cumgffxt36hsqzucrup
transaction
3dd06cbf207889641cf320a3369f1580cdc28a2319b305f70ac0958e0d4b2876
spent
true